Due to the over-collection of pet trade and habitat loss, the numbers of hyacinth macaws in the wild have been declining. The hyacinth Macaw is listed on the CITES Appendix I and is protected by laws in Brazil and Paraguay.
Although hyacinth Macaws may not be the most fluent of macaws in terms of their ability to speak, they are still highly intelligent. They can master a few words and phrases and imitate sounds. Hyacinth Macaws form strong bonds with humans if they are socialized appropriately.
In the wild, hyacinth Macaws generally live in pairs and communicate through loud calls. They feed on fruits, leafy greens and nuts, especially palm nuts like Bocaiuva and Acuri. Their beaks are strong enough to crack coconuts. Their airborne seed dissemination services are beneficial to biodiversity and forest ecosystems.
They are essential to the survival of a number of other tree and plant species. Hyacinth Macaws can be found in the wild in Central and Eastern South America. Three main populations are present, with the majority of the population concentrated around Brazil's Pantanal wetland region and in the Cerrado and Amazon basin regions in the east of the country. They prefer living in woodlands, palm swamps and similar semi-open areas and usually avoid dense forests. Their beaks are able to crack coconuts and they feed on the nuts of the bocaiuva and acuri palms.
